Bitwarden's app can receive CXP passkeys, so you can install a passkey in Apple's password manager, CXP it to Bitwarden, and then export it to a file that you control.
Putting the file under your control does make it possible for someone to trick you into sending you that file, undermining some of the phishing protections of passkeys. It’s up to you to decide whether protecting yourself from being tricked into exporting your passkeys is worth sacrificing your ability to read them.

And I think for FIDO2 keys, this is fine. If I can register a key (plus a backup) the usage doesn't seem so different from a regular key.
For the rest, I think what irks me is the feeling of "you have free choice which corporation you want to entrust all your login credentials with, but you will have to choose one". Previously, password managers were a convenience (that incidentally also increased security, because they made keeping a separate, hard password for each domain practically feasible) - but nothing stopped me from keeping passwords at several different places at once or memorizing some of them, in case I lose access to the password manager.
Now suddenly, they become the arbiters of my logins everywhere. What happens if they ban me, or go out of business or get bought up? (Or in Apple or Google's case, make arbitrary business decisions that can now affect the way I login to completely unrelated services?)
